When using any type of power equipment, what must be checked before handing up any instrument?
a. Make sure the instrument is in "on" mode and ready to be used.
b. The instrument must be in "off" mode.
c. Check to make sure the instrument is in the "safety" mode.
d. Make sure the instrument is unassembled and in the "on" mode.
ANS: C
Ensure that the power instrument is in "safety" mode so that it does not unintentionally injure a surgical team member.
